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5694 631177905 92449063 212893535 71105745
452 4438688927 1529111452
452 4438688927 1529111452
234302465 0389763 0939341295
All about undefined
Interested in learning more?
452 4438688927 1529111452
234302465 0389763 0939341295
See more
42697 408
542485 446 724229
See more
60 08
96194744811 91 234498 73228751
See more